Make Your Mark:

The Account Manager, SAP serves as the client advocate, providing customers with a consistent level of professional support in an effort to develop and maintain relationships throughout the lifecycle of the account. A key role of this position is setting and communicating expectations, both within the organization and externally with the client.This role is selling BlackLine’s products to Controllers & CFOs of corporations in the US with annual revenue of $750 million to $10 Billion. The Account Manager, SAP is assigned an account list to manage, develop and market BlackLine’s solutions to secure new business in our Software-as-a-Service business model. Working in collaboration with sales leadership and the sales operations team, the Account Manager, SAP engages with VP, Sr. VP and C-level contacts within prospective customers developing relationships and closing business at or above expected and assigned levels per period.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
